By Associated Press

Defense Secretary Lloyd Austin underwent a medical procedure at Walter Reed National Military Medical Center on Friday night and has resumed his duties after temporarily transferring power to his deputy, the Pentagon press secretary said. Maj. Gen. Pat Ryder, in a statement.

Austin is still dealing with bladder problems that emerged in December after his treatment for prostate cancer, Ryder said.

The procedure was successful, elective and minimally invasive, “unrelated to his cancer diagnosis and has had no effect on his excellent cancer prognosis,” the press secretary said.

Austin transferred authority to Deputy Defense Secretary Kathleen Hicks for about two and a half hours while he was indisposed, the Pentagon said.

The head of the Pentagon returned home after the intervention. “No changes are anticipated to his official schedule at this time, to include his participation in the events scheduled for Memorial Day,” Ryder said.

Austin, 70, has had ongoing health problems since undergoing surgery to deal with a prostate cancer diagnosis. He spent two weeks in the hospital for complications from a prostatectomy. Austin was criticized at the time for not immediately informing the president, Joe Biden, or Congress of his diagnosis or his hospitalization.

Austin was transferred back to Walter Reed in February for a bladder problem, admitted to intensive care for a second time and underwent a non-surgical intervention under anesthesia general at that time.

The Pentagon notified the White House and Congress on this occasion, Ryder said.
